Common Twovermsg.exe Errors on Windows

Dealing with twovermsg.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with twovermsg.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.

  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This alert comes up when the system runs into a critical error leading to a crash. This could be triggered by hardware malfunctions, driver incompatibility, or significant software glitches impacting the system's overall stability.
  • Not a Valid Win32 Application: This alert pops up when the system is unable to start a program, either due to incompatibility with the current Windows version or potential corruption of the program file.
  • Twovermsg.exe has Stopped Working: This warning is displayed when the system detects that the executable file is no longer performing as expected. This can be caused by software errors, interference from other applications, or system resource limitations.
  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This warning is shown when the application fails to start as it should, typically caused by an inconsistency between the 32-bit and 64-bit versions of the application and the Windows operating system.
  • Error 0xc0000142: This error message appears when an application wasn't able to start correctly, often due to issues in the software itself, corrupted files, or problems with Windows registry.

Step 1: Open Windows Memory Diagnostic

Step 1: Open Windows Memory Diagnostic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Windows Memory Diagnostic in the search bar and press Enter.

Step 2: Start the Diagnostic Process

Step 2: Start the Diagnostic Process Thumbnail
  1. In the Windows Memory Diagnostic window, click on Restart now and check for problems (recommended).

Step 3: Wait for the Diagnostic to Complete

Step 3: Wait for the Diagnostic to Complete Thumbnail
  1. Your computer will restart and the memory diagnostic will run automatically. It might take some time.

Step 4: Check the Results

Step 4: Check the Results Thumbnail
  1. After the diagnostic, your computer will restart again. You can check the results in the notification area on your desktop.

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the memory diagnostic, check if the twovermsg.exe problem persists.

Step 1: Open Device Manager

Step 1: Open Device Manager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Device Manager in the search bar and press Enter.

Step 2: Identify the Driver to Update

Step 2: Identify the Driver to Update Thumbnail
  1. In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.

  2.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.

  3. Right-click on the device and select Update driver.

Step 3: Update the Driver

Step 3: Update the Driver Thumbnail
  1. In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.

  2. Follow the prompts to install the driver update.

Step 4: Restart Your Computer

Step 4: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. After the driver update is installed, restart your computer.
